All The Money In The World Is A Compelling Biography Of The Getty Family, Tracing The Ascent Of One Of America's Wealthiest Dynasties And The Dramatic Personal Stories That Accompanied It. Part History, Part Biography, This Book Invites Readers Who Love Rich, Real-Life Narratives—History Buffs, Business Enthusiasts, And Film Fans Alike—To Explore A World Of Power, Money, And Family Drama. The Tone Is Suspenseful Yet Thoughtful, Offering Insight Into The Costs And Consequences Of Enormous Wealth.
John Pearson's All The Money In The World Chronicles The Getty Saga With Careful Research And A Storyteller's Instinct For Scene And Motive. The Book Surveys The Family’S Rise, The Empire They Built, And The Public Machinations That Surrounded Them, From Boardroom Battles To The Infamous Kidnapping Of Paul Getty. Written In Clear, Engaging Prose, It Reads Like A Compelling Narrative While Remaining Firmly Grounded In Fact.
Structured Around Intimate Portraits Of Its Principal Players, All The Money In The World Blends Dramatic Episodes With Historical Context To Illuminate How Wealth Shapes Choices, Loyalties, And Legacy. Readers Will Encounter Vivid Characters, Bold Decisions, And Eye-Opening Discoveries About Business, Art, Philanthropy, And Media Influence.
